Short description

Is this gated community swimming in danger? When a body is found face down in the private neighborhood pool, Sheriff Jim Murray is called to investigate. He is shocked by the many passions and secrets that float to the surface in the lives of the proper upper-class residents.

Amy Barkman is the founder and director of Voice of Joy Ministries since 1970, pastor of Mortonsville United Methodist Church since 1998. She and her husband Gary live in Kentucky and have five daughters and 13 grandchildren. She loves cozy mysteries and travel, especially to England and Disney World.
